
Exspect, a company that manufactures portable power input technology, has lifted the curtains on a compact rechargeable smart battery gadget that helps provide some juice on-demand at any moment. The ReCharge4 range of portable devices help keep a gamut of gadgets and gizmos powered, including cellphones, handheld consoles, portable media players, and digital audio players. It is essentially an independent portable power supply, capable of powering a single device up to 4 times from a single mains charge. The ReCharge4 comes with a display that tells you how much juice left it contains so that you won’t get caught with a dead digital camera when you’re about to take that money shot. The ReCharge4 unit is currently going for £39.99.
